Output ef0793b74be2819020d55fea7aac1abc2d7364c6e7a0a32ab8c80d2109d0e749:39

value
5958237
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0a3aee455801f5ee48cb62f400c40476022304ae OP_EQUALVERIFY OP_CHECKSIG
address
1w6MVuFe69ZhdBTeXAqQDFTwLBfwQeq4b
transaction
ef0793b74be2819020d55fea7aac1abc2d7364c6e7a0a32ab8c80d2109d0e749
confirmations
265570
spent
true